2017-04-16 0:53 GMT+08:00 Stefan Agner <stefan@xxxxxxxx>:
> On 2017-04-15 07:52, Axel Lin wrote:
>> The commit "regulator: rn5t618: Add RN5T567 PMIC support" added
>> RN5T618_DCDC4 to the enum, then RN5T618_REG_NUM is also changed.
>> So for rn5t618, there is out of bounds array access when checking
>> regulators[i].name in the for loop.
>
> I use designated initializers ([RN5T618_##rid] = {..), which guarantee
> that the non initialized elements are zero. The highest element LDORTC2
> is defined, hence the length of the array should be RN5T618_REG_NUM.

ok, I missed that. Then current code is fine.
Though the meaing of RN5T618_REG_NUM seems misleading to me as different
variant has differnt number of regulators.
